From 3e155e3d928c81aedbb7aead8f91686a4571dd1c Mon Sep 17 00:00:00 2001 From: daz Date: Wed, 10 Apr 2024 13:11:19 -0600 Subject: [PATCH] Avoid running incompatible tests on Windows --- .github/workflows/integ-test-dependency-graph.yml | 6 +----- .github/workflows/integ-test-dependency-submission.yml | 6 +----- 2 files changed, 2 insertions(+), 10 deletions(-) diff --git a/.github/workflows/integ-test-dependency-graph.yml b/.github/workflows/integ-test-dependency-graph.yml index 5ed3c3f..3f5a2ce 100644 --- a/.github/workflows/integ-test-dependency-graph.yml +++ b/.github/workflows/integ-test-dependency-graph.yml @@ -116,11 +116,7 @@ jobs: fi config-cache: - strategy: - fail-fast: false - matrix: - os: ${{fromJSON(inputs.runner-os)}} - runs-on: ${{ matrix.os }} + runs-on: ubuntu-latest # Test is not compatible with Windows steps: - name: Checkout sources uses: actions/checkout@v4 diff --git a/.github/workflows/integ-test-dependency-submission.yml b/.github/workflows/integ-test-dependency-submission.yml index 3d0835b..5e4ec0f 100644 --- a/.github/workflows/integ-test-dependency-submission.yml +++ b/.github/workflows/integ-test-dependency-submission.yml @@ -158,11 +158,7 @@ jobs: build-root-directory: .github/workflow-samples/groovy-dsl config-cache: - strategy: - fail-fast: false - matrix: - os: ${{fromJSON(inputs.runner-os)}} - runs-on: ${{ matrix.os }} + runs-on: ubuntu-latest # Test is not compatible with Windows steps: - name: Checkout sources uses: actions/checkout@v4